当前位置: 首页>>代码示例>>TypeScript>>正文


TypeScript Slides.slideTo方法代码示例

本文整理汇总了TypeScript中ionic-angular.Slides.slideTo方法的典型用法代码示例。如果您正苦于以下问题:TypeScript Slides.slideTo方法的具体用法?TypeScript Slides.slideTo怎么用?TypeScript Slides.slideTo使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在ionic-angular.Slides的用法示例。


在下文中一共展示了Slides.slideTo方法的5个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的TypeScript代码示例。

示例1: goToSlide

    goToSlide(str) {

      let user = this.users[this.slides.getActiveIndex()];
      let index = this.slides.getActiveIndex();


      if (str == 'like') {

          let params = JSON.stringify({
              toUser: user.id,
          });

          this.http.post(this.api.url + '/user/like/' + user.id, params, this.api.setHeaders(true)).subscribe(data => {

          });

          this.users.splice(index, 1);
          this.slides.slideTo(index,1);

      } else {


          if (this.slides.isEnd()) {
              //this.slides.slideNext();
              //var that = this;
              //setTimeout(function () {
              this.slides.slideTo(0,1);
              //this.slides.update();
              //}, 10);
          } else {
              this.slides.slideNext();
          }
      }
    }
开发者ID:interdate,项目名称:SheDate-Android,代码行数:34,代码来源:arena.ts

示例2: Date

        this.platform.registerBackButtonAction(() => {
            if (this.isMessagesOpened) {
                this.isMessagesOpened = false;
                return;
            }
            if (this.navPath.length < 1) {
                if (new Date().getTime() - lastTimeBackPress < timePeriodToExit) {
                    this.platform.exitApp();
                } else {
                    let toast = this.toastCtrl.create({
                        message:  'Press back again to exit',
                        duration: 3000,
                        position: 'bottom'
                    });
                    toast.present();
                    lastTimeBackPress = new Date().getTime();
                }
                return;
            }

            this.navPath.pop();
            this.slide = this.navPath[this.navPath.length - 1];
            this.slides.slideTo(this.slide);
            this.isGoingBack = true;
        });
开发者ID:qwb0920,项目名称:birdchain-mvp,代码行数:25,代码来源:layout.component.ts

示例3: switchSlide

 switchSlide(index) {
     this.slide = index;
     this.slides.slideTo(index);
     if (this.isMessagesOpened) {
         this.isMessagesOpened = false;
     }
 }
开发者ID:qwb0920,项目名称:birdchain-mvp,代码行数:7,代码来源:layout.component.ts

示例4: ionViewDidEnter

  /**
   * This method will be invoked everytime when come back.
   */
  public ionViewDidEnter(): void {
    // Just set it again. <!! DO NOT REMOVE THIS LINE !!>
    this.selectedVehicle = this.appState.userSelectedVehicle;

    if (this.userVehicleList && this.userVehicleList.length && this.selectedVehicle) {
      // This will make Slides move to Selected vehicle.
      const vehicleIndex = this.userVehicleList.indexOf(this.selectedVehicle);
      this.vehicleSlide.slideTo(vehicleIndex || 0);
    }
  }
开发者ID:PoompisekK,项目名称:myWork,代码行数:13,代码来源:select-car.page.ts

示例5: switchSlide

 switchSlide(index) {
     this.slides.lockSwipes(false);
     this.slides.slideTo(index);
 }
开发者ID:qwb0920,项目名称:birdchain-mvp,代码行数:4,代码来源:intro.component.ts


注:本文中的ionic-angular.Slides.slideTo方法示例由纯净天空整理自Github/MSDocs等开源代码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。